AETNA CASUALTY & SURETY CO. v. HUMBOLDT LOADERS

Docket No. A032342.

202 Cal.App.3d 921 (1988)

249 Cal. Rptr. 175

AETNA CASUALTY AND SURETY COMPANY, Plaintiff and Appellant, v. HUMBOLDT LOADERS, INC., et al., Defendants and Respondents; BOLLING, WALTER & GAWTHROP, Objector and Appellant.

Court of Appeals of California, First District, Division Two.

July 11, 1988.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

COUNSEL

Craig E. Farmer, George E. Murphy and Bolling, Walter & Gawthrop for Plaintiff and Appellant and Objector and Appellant.

John W. Warren, Mitchell, Dedekam & Angell and Clifford B. Mitchell for Defendants and Respondents.


OPINION

SMITH, J.

Prior to commencement of trial, appellant Aetna Casualty & Surety Company (Aetna) attempted to dismiss its complaint for declaratory relief against respondents Humboldt Loaders, Inc., its owners Barbara Knapp and Gary Blanks and others who claimed coverage under Aetna's comprehensive general liability insurance contract with Humboldt.
